Host is running FreeBSD 14.0-CURRENT #88 main-n247993-7a0c0ff7ee2: Thu Jul 15
08:08:53 CEST 2021 amd64, KTLS enabled (if it matters).
databses/postgresql13-server|client are installed and have been recompiled
recently via "portmaster -df", even today the binaries have been recompiled
again to asure the problem is not to be caused by outdated binaries.

Authetication method switched to SCRAM-SHA-256, passwords reset accordingly.

Problem: connecting to the DB server from the local machine via socket causes
no problem. Connecting to the DB server on the local machine from the local
machine via "-h 127.0.0.1" or "-h ::1" or "-h localhost" does end up in a very
long login phase which ends with 

psql: error: server closed the connection unexpectedly
        This probably means the server terminated abnormally
        before or while processing the request.

From a remote machine, also 14-CURRENT of the same state and with pgsql from
databases/postgresql13-client, I receive the same - the server's log does show
a connection entry like

2021-07-15 13:11:57.420 CEST [52991] LOG:  connection received:
host=host.name.bla port=33146

and nothing further.

I tried to adjust pg_hba.conf according to host/hostssl entries for remote
login (the user in question is allowed to remotely login) and played around
with this, tried as many permutations as possible, without success.

Connecting from a host running a recent FreeBSD 13-STABLE-p3, also with a
recent databases/postgresql13-client, connecting to the DB running on the
14-CURRENT box gives me:

psql: error: SSL SYSCALL error: EOF detected

The ppstgresql server seems to be completely "off grid" when it comes to
network access, even when IPFW is configured to allow any to any (of course I
have configured remote access and opened port 5432/tcp).

I'm out of ideas here. On FreeBSD 13-STABLE running psql 12 or 13 I do not see
such problems.
